Care Coordinator
The Care Coordinator role provides a wide range of clinical support duties and is an integral part of the medical care team. The Care Coordinator independently performs clinical administrative and technical functions that is critical within the department of Pediatric Urology. This position will ensure that the patient care is seamless and that the continuity of care is achieved for every patient. The main tasks are to systematically bridge gaps between numerous services necessary for patient care such as laboratory and imaging, specialty care, primary care, social work and communicate the plan to the patient and patient's representative. This position also supports providers daily by performing clinical administrative duties within their scope such as order entry, managing lab results, scheduling appointments and coordinating. This position will also support the clinical team by reviewing scheduled appointments and coordinating the needs prior, during and after the visit. This role will work under the clinical direction of the physicians and directly reports to the Clinic Operations Supervisor.
Function/Duties of Position
- Patient Care Management - Responsible for coordinating and managing aspects of the patient's clinical care process. Works with the providers by providing support with medication refills, DME and provides support to the patient and family. Places lab, diagnostic and scheduling orders as directed by the physicians and coordinates with facilities and patients. Monitors the Epic In Basket messages and ensures timely response is received by patient, providers and answers messages within their scope. Monitors refill request received in Epic and from Right fax and manages this efficiently to avoid disruption in patient care. Manages Prior Authorization and processes appeals appropriately.
- Care coordination - Ensures patients follow through with outside referrals to other specialties, labs and diagnostic imaging. Supports multi-disciplinary teams such as SpinaBifida and Stone Clinic.
- Communication - Provides information and education to patients, family members, and referring physician office staffs. Acts as communication link with physicians, nurses, referring physician offices, ancillary services, and patients. Provides accurate patient information. Responds to voice mail and email messages based on priority of patient process and as triaged by the RNs. Attends MD/department team meetings as appropriate. Responds to patient questions in Mychart, phone calls, emails, and faxes in regard to scheduling or care issues within scope.
- Documentation/Data Management - Documents legibly, concisely and completely to ensure that others can accurately assess the status of patients' progress by reviewing that documentation. Participates as assigned with database input. Initiate and implement processes to facilitate new protocol implementation and tracking tools as indicated.
- Other tasks and duties as assigned.
Required Qualifications
Three years' experience in a hospital or hospital based clinic setting, AND
High School diploma or equivalent, AND
Positions with in person patient care: BLS certificate within 30 days of hire or prior to independent practice, whichever comes first, AND
One of the following four:
- Completion of a nationally recognized accredited medical assistant training program, including a practicum (externship) of at least 160 hours, OR
- Successful completion of a formal medical services training program of the United States Armed Forces, OR
- Current Oregon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) license (basic or advance) and national EMT registration with the National Registry of Emergency Medical Technicians (NREMT), OR
- Current Oregon Practical Nurse License OR
- For dental school hires only as an alternative to qualifications 1-4: Completion of a Dental Assistant training program and successful completion of the DANB exam
For those completing medical assistant training or formal military medical services training as referenced above in #1 and #2, the following is also required (Those qualifying under the EMT or LPN or Dental Assistant qualification are exempt from this requirement.)
MA certification received from a nationally recognized and accredited certifying body, upon hire or by the completion of the probationary period or internal job change evaluation period, as appropriate. Currently, these include:
- The American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A), awarding the Certified Medical Assistant (CMA.)
- The American Medical Technologists (AMT), awarding the Registered Medical Assistant (R.M.A.)
- The National Center for Competency Testing, awarding the National Certified MA (NCMA.)
- The National Health Career Association, awarding the Certified Clinical Medical Assistant (CCMA.)
Any applicable certifications or licensures must be maintained for the duration of employment.
In addition to receiving the appropriate certification noted above, Medical and Dental Assistants will be required to successfully demonstrate competencies prior to completion of probation or the internal job change evaluation period, as appropriate.
